Towns and villages to visit

Vallon Pont d’Arc : The tourist heart of Ardèche, Vallon Pont d’Arc is famous for its impressive natural limestone bridge which spans the river. This village is also the ideal starting point for exploring the Ardèche gorges, offering activities such as canoeing, hiking and caving.

Balazuc : Perched on a cliff overlooking the Ardèche river, Balazuc is classified among the “Most Beautiful Villages in France”. With its narrow medieval streets, its stone houses and its Romanesque church, this village is a window open to the past.

Vogüé : Vogüé is distinguished by its medieval castle which dominates the village and offers a panoramic view of the Ardèche valley. The cobbled streets and arcades add to the charm of this village, where it is good to stroll and discover the small craft shops.

Labeaume : Nestled in a meander of the Beaume river, Labeaume charms with its pebble beaches, its limestone cliffs and its streets lined with stone houses. It is an ideal place for swimming in summer and for the classical music concerts which are regularly organized there.

Saint-Montan : Rebuilt and restored by volunteers, Saint-Montan offers a journey back in time with its feudal castle, its narrow streets and its stone houses typical of Ardèche. It is an excellent starting point for hikes in the surrounding scrubland.

Alba-la-Romaine : Known for its archaeological site and its museum which illustrate life during Antiquity, Alba-la-Romaine is also famous for its theater festival. The village, with its cobbled streets and Roman remains, offers a unique atmosphere that combines history and culture.

The most emblematic sites of Ardèche

The Ardèche is full of emblematic sites that captivate both with their natural beauty and their historical and cultural importance. Here’s a more detailed exploration of these must-see places, including Aven d’Orgnac, a major addition to the department’s list of wonders:

Ardèche Gorges and Pont d’Arc : This spectacular canyon, formed by the Ardèche River, is famous for the Pont d’Arc, a 60 meter wide natural arch. The gorge offers an exceptional playground for canoeing, as well as numerous lookouts offering breathtaking views of the limestone cliffs and serpentine river.

Aven d’Orgnac : Classified as a Grand Site de France, the Aven d’Orgnac is an immense cave decorated with giant stalactites and stalagmites. Its main room, as high as a cathedral, impresses with its dimensions and the beauty of its limestone formations. The site also includes a Prehistory Museum, enriching the visit with an educational perspective on the first inhabitants of the region.

Caverne du Pont d’Arc (replica of the Chauvet Cave) : This faithful replica allows visitors to discover the cave paintings of the Chauvet Cave, listed as a UNESCO world heritage site. Works dating back more than 36,000 years bear witness to the cultural and artistic richness of the first modern humans in Europe.

Mont Gerbier de Jonc : Source of the Loire, Mont Gerbier de Jonc is a volcanic seep which offers a panoramic view of the mountainous Ardèche. The climb to the summit is a popular hike, offering spectacular perspectives and direct contact with the intense nature of the area.
